Milankovitch Cycles

Long-term, periodic changes in Earth's orbit and rotation that control how much sunlight reaches our planet and drives ice age cycles

21
New cards

Eccentricity

Shape of the Earth’s orbit around the sun shifts from circular to elliptical over a period of 100,000-400,000 years

22
New cards

Obliquity

The tilt angle of Earth’s rotational axis varies between 22.1º and 24.5º over a cycle of about 41,000 years

23
New cards

Precession

Slow wobble of Earth’s rotational axis produces a circle every 26,000 years
